How to Create a QR Code for a Word Document?

A step-by-step guide:

  1. Go to the free online QR generator and select URL or QR code category with URL. Upload your document to a web server or FTP or a storage platform like DropBox, Google Drive, OneDrive, or similar. QR code solutions can be PDF, image, audio, video, MP3, GIF, and any file type.
  2. Generate and customize your QR code. Here you can select pattern sets, eye shapes, and colors; and add a logo and a call to action label. This way, your QR code recipients will know who's sending these codes.
  3. Test and download your Word document's QR code. To ensure the scan-ability of the QR code, perform several test scans to catch any scanning issues. For a thorough test, use different devices with different OS to identify any scanning delays. Once satisfied, download your QR code in print quality. Vector file formats like SVG are best for this purpose.
  4. Deploy on print and digital platforms. Word QR codes can be scanned in print and even from a computer screen, making them versatile. After downloading your QR code, deploy it on both print and digital platforms.

Why are Dynamic QR Codes Better for Embedding Word Documents?

  1. Create Better Images: Dynamic QR codes have a cleaner, minimalist look. Unlike static QR images, where data is stored graphically, dynamic QRs store data online, resulting in cleaner images.
  2. Store More Data: Dynamic QRs can store more data than static ones.
  3. Avoid Scan Errors: Dynamic QRs reduce scan errors as they store data in a more secure system.
  4. Trackable: You can track data like scan count, device used, scan date, and scanner location.
  5. Editable Content: You can edit dynamic QR content without regenerating and reprinting new QR codes.
  6. Saves Money in the Long Run: Change the Word document file behind the QR even after printing, saving reprint costs.
  7. Share Word Documents: Easily share and download using smart devices.
